There are 6 horses in the barn what is the ratio of horse ears to horse feet

Respuesta :

MahdiNaseri
MahdiNaseri MahdiNaseri
  • 12-09-2018

The ratio is 1/2.

Each horse has 2 ears, so 6 x 2 = 12

Each horse has 4 feet, so 6 x 4 = 24
